The Extrusion Process

Small aluminum extrusion begins with the creation of a die that matches the desired profile of the extruded part. The aluminum billet is heated to a specific temperature and then forced through the die using a hydraulic press or ram. As the aluminum passes through the die, it takes on the shape of the die cavity and emerges on the other side as a continuous length of profile. This profile can then be cut to the desired length and further processed as needed.

Industries That Utilize Small Aluminum Extrusion

Small aluminum extrusion is widely used in a variety of industries, including automotive, aerospace, construction, electronics, and more. In the automotive industry, small aluminum extrusion is used to create lightweight components that help improve fuel efficiency. In the aerospace industry, it is used to fabricate complex structural components that meet stringent performance requirements. In the construction industry, small aluminum extrusion is utilized for architectural elements such as window frames, curtain walls, and handrails.

Applications of Small Aluminum Extrusion

Small aluminum extrusion finds its way into a diverse range of applications due to its versatility and flexibility. In the electronics industry, small aluminum extrusion is used to create heat sinks that dissipate heat from electronic components. In the furniture industry, it is used to create lightweight but sturdy frames for tables, chairs, and shelving units. In the medical industry, small aluminum extrusion is used to create components for medical devices and equipment.
